Ikuti langkah-langkah ini untuk membuat tabel di pengembang Oracle SQL.
- Buka Pengembang Oracle SQL.
- Hubungkan ke Basis Data.
- Di sisi kiri, klik nama skema untuk memperluas node.
- Kemudian pilih node Tabel dan lakukan klik kanan padanya.
- Pilih Tabel Baru opsi dari menu pintasan untuk membuat tabel.
- A Buat Tabel jendela akan muncul, seperti yang ditunjukkan pada contoh di bawah ini.
- Di jendela Buat Tabel, pertama, pilih kotak centang Lanjutan di kanan untuk menampilkan semua opsi untuk tabel di sisi kiri jendela.
- Kemudian pilih skema dari daftar drop-down Skema, secara default ini menunjukkan skema saat ini.
- Tentukan nama tabel di bidang Nama. Seperti yang ditunjukkan pada gambar di atas.
- Pilih jenis tabel dari daftar tarik-turun jenis tabel.
- Kemudian mulailah dengan menentukan kolom untuk tabel di bagian Kolom pada jendela.
- Klik kolom PK jika ingin membuat kolom primary key. Kemudian tentukan nama kolom, tipe data dan panjangnya, kolom dapat nullable atau tidak dan nilai default jika ada untuk kolom tersebut.
- Ulangi tindakan untuk setiap kolom baru dan setelah menyelesaikan pembuatan kolom, klik tombol OK untuk membuat tabel. Anda juga dapat menggunakan opsi lain di jendela ini, seperti Batasan, Indeks, Partisi sesuai kebutuhan tabel Anda.
Anda sekarang telah membuat tabel baru menggunakan Oracle SQL Developer. Berikut ini adalah contoh pernyataan DDL untuk tabel yang baru dibuat.
CREATE TABLE SCOTT.EMP_CONTACT_INFO ( EMPNO NUMBER(10) NOT NULL , PRIMARY_CONTACT_NO VARCHAR2(20) NOT NULL , SECONDRY_CONTACT_NO VARCHAR2(20) , ADDR_LINE_1 VARCHAR2(100) NOT NULL , ADDR_LINE_2 VARCHAR2(100) , CITY VARCHAR2(50) DEFAULT 'UP' NOT NULL , STATE VARCHAR2(50) NOT NULL , CONSTRAINT EMP_CONTACT_INFO_PK PRIMARY KEY ( EMPNO ) ENABLE );
Lihat juga:
- Cara membuat prosedur di Oracle SQL Developer
- Cara mengubah struktur tabel di Oracle SQL Developer
-
Bagaimana cara memanggil fungsi Oracle dari Hibernate dengan parameter pengembalian?
-
Bagaimana cara mengonversi teks menjadi angka secara efisien di Oracle PL/SQL dengan NLS_NUMERIC_CHARACTERS non-default?
-
Database Oracle tergantung tanpa batas dalam kueri UPDATE
-
RETENSI LOB
-
Indeks Oracle dan jenis indeks di Oracle dengan contoh